The Victorian Aboriginal Child and Community Agency (VACCA) is a statewide Aboriginal Community Controlled Organisation (ACCO) servicing children, young people, families, and community members in Victoria.

VACCA is Victoria’s peak voice for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ander children. As the largest organisation of its kind, VACCA has protected and promoted the rights of Aboriginal children, young people, families and community since 1977.

Ngwala Willumbong Aboriginal Corporation (Ngwala) is a State-wide Community Controlled Organisation serving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ander communities across Victoria. We provide Alcohol and Drug Treatment and Recovery, Homelessness programs, Public Intoxication Responses, Counselling, Family Violence support, Youth services and more.
